Preparation tips
- Wash the watercress thoroughly just before use, as sandy grit hides between the stems. Add the leaves only at the end of cooking so the peppery flavour and bright green colour stay fresh rather than turning bitter.
- For an extra refined texture, pass the blended soup through a fine sieve before serving. A spoonful of crème fraîche or a few reserved watercress leaves makes an elegant garnish for dinner parties.
- This soup keeps well in the fridge for up to two days and can be frozen in portions. Replace the potatoes with celeriac for a lighter version, or stir in a little butter at the end for extra richness.
Recipe variations
- Lactose-free version: replace the unsalted butter with olive oil and finish the soup with a splash of oat cream. The peppery watercress flavour remains fully intact while the soup becomes completely plant-based and dairy-free.
- Festive winter version: add a peeled pear to the potatoes while simmering and serve with crispy bacon bits and toasted hazelnuts on top. The subtle sweetness of the pear balances the sharp watercress beautifully.
